Default Re: DMV Electronic Title Question



I've done both of the above before. You will have to pay $10 to get the title in print, though. You need the paper one to sign over. Don't forget to use www.dmvnow.com site to list the car as sold immediately after the transaction so you don't get caught up in whatever happens after it's sold, otherwise DMV won't know it's sold until the new owner registers it in their name.
